Product Overview

The Bently Nevada 3500/94M-07-00-00 is a specialized Display Router Box designed for the 3500 Series Machinery Protection System. This configuration is specifically engineered for multi-rack installations where a centralized display is required. As the "07" option, this unit functions as a router box without an integrated display, allowing up to four separate 3500 racks to share a single VGA monitor or touchscreen interface. This architecture streamlines data visualization and reduces hardware costs in large-scale industrial plants.

Technical Configuration

Multi-Rack Signal Routing

The 3500/94M-07-00-00 serves as the communication hub for complex monitoring networks. It features four dedicated VGA video inputs and four RS232 touch screen control data inputs. These inputs consolidate vibration data and status alerts from multiple racks into a single output stream, enabling a unified operator interface via the secondary VGA and RS232 output ports.

Power and Status Monitoring

The router box operates on a highly stable +24 Vdc supply with a tight ±6% tolerance. It consumes a maximum of 4.7 watts, ensuring minimal thermal impact on control cabinets. A front-panel "OK" status LED provides immediate visual confirmation of the hardware's operational integrity, signaling that the routing internal logic is functioning correctly and signals are being processed without loss.

System Integration Requirements

In a standard deployment, the 3500/94M-07-00-00 must be paired with the 3500/94M VGA module and its associated I/O card in the rack. To manage multiple racks, engineers typically install this router box in the first rack, while subsequent racks utilize display units or additional router box cables to complete the visual network loop.

Installation & Ordering Guide

Multi-Rack Setup Procedure

When configuring a system with one display for multiple racks, the 3500/94M-07-00-00 is the foundational component for the primary rack. For a four-rack configuration, the first rack uses the router box, the second rack contains the actual display unit, and the remaining racks are integrated using router box cables (P/N 3500/94M-00-12-XX).

Cabling and Power Safety

Ensure that all VGA and RS232 cables are industrial shielded types to maintain signal clarity over the routing distance. Since this module manages touch screen data, the RS232 connections must be secure to prevent "ghost touches" or control latency. Always verify the input voltage range is between 22.5 and 25.5 Vdc before energizing the system.

Technical FAQs

Q1: Does this specific model include an LCD screen?

A1: No, the 07 option indicates a Router Box only. It is designed to route signals to a separate display unit located elsewhere in the system architecture.

Q2: How many racks can I connect to one router box?

A2: The router box features 4 sets of inputs, allowing you to consolidate data from up to four 3500 monitoring racks into one output display.

Q3: Is a separate power supply required for the router box?

A3: The unit requires +24 Vdc. Depending on your ordering configuration, a power supply cable may be included, but it must be connected to a stable 22.5 to 25.5 Vdc source.
